モネロ(XMR)マイニングの仕組みと設備投資の目安
はじめに
モネロ(Monero, XMR)は、プライバシー保護に重点を置いた暗号資産であり、その特徴的な技術により、取引の匿名性を高めています。モネロのマイニングは、他の暗号資産とは異なるアルゴリズムを採用しており、その仕組みを理解することは、マイニングへの参入を検討する上で不可欠です。本稿では、モネロのマイニングの仕組みを詳細に解説し、設備投資の目安について考察します。
モネロのマイニングアルゴリズム:RandomX
モネロは、当初CPUマイニングに適したCryptoNightアルゴリズムを採用していましたが、ASICマイニング耐性を持たせるため、2019年にRandomXアルゴリズムに移行しました。RandomXは、CPUの性能を最大限に活用するように設計されており、ASICによるマイニングを困難にしています。これは、マイニングの分散性を維持し、ネットワークのセキュリティを向上させることを目的としています。
RandomXの動作原理
RandomXは、仮想マシン上でランダムなコードを実行することでマイニングを行います。このランダムなコードは、CPUのキャッシュや分岐予測ユニットなどの機能を活用するように設計されており、ASICでは効率的に処理することができません。具体的には、以下のステップでマイニングが行われます。
- プログラム生成: RandomXは、ランダムな命令セットを持つプログラムを生成します。
- メモリ初期化: 生成されたプログラムを実行するために必要なメモリ領域を初期化します。
- プログラム実行: 生成されたプログラムをCPU上で実行します。
- ハッシュ計算: プログラムの実行結果に基づいてハッシュ値を計算します。
- PoW検証: 計算されたハッシュ値が、ネットワークが設定する難易度を満たしているか検証します。
このプロセスを繰り返すことで、モネロのブロックが生成され、マイナーは報酬を得ることができます。
モネロマイニングに必要な設備
モネロのマイニングは、主にCPUを使用して行われます。GPUやASICを使用することも可能ですが、RandomXアルゴリズムの特性上、CPUが最も効率的な選択肢となります。以下に、モネロマイニングに必要な設備を詳細に説明します。
CPU
RandomXアルゴリズムは、CPUのコア数、クロック周波数、キャッシュサイズなどがマイニング性能に大きく影響します。一般的に、コア数が多いCPUほど、マイニング性能が高くなります。AMD RyzenシリーズやIntel Core iシリーズのハイエンドCPUが推奨されます。特に、AMD Ryzen 9シリーズは、高いコア数と優れたコストパフォーマンスを両立しており、モネロマイニングに適しています。
マザーボード
CPUの性能を最大限に引き出すためには、高品質なマザーボードが必要です。CPUソケットの種類、チップセット、メモリのサポート容量などを考慮して、適切なマザーボードを選択する必要があります。複数のCPUを搭載できるサーバーグレードのマザーボードも選択肢の一つです。
メモリ
RandomXアルゴリズムは、大量のメモリを使用します。そのため、十分な容量のメモリを搭載する必要があります。一般的に、32GB以上のDDR4メモリが推奨されます。メモリの速度もマイニング性能に影響するため、可能な限り高速なメモリを選択することが望ましいです。
ストレージ
オペレーティングシステムやマイニングソフトウェアをインストールするためのストレージが必要です。SSDを使用することで、システムの起動やソフトウェアの動作を高速化することができます。容量は、128GB以上のSSDが推奨されます。
電源ユニット
CPU、マザーボード、メモリ、ストレージなどのすべてのコンポーネントに電力を供給するための電源ユニットが必要です。消費電力の合計を考慮して、十分な容量の電源ユニットを選択する必要があります。80 PLUS認証を取得した高品質な電源ユニットが推奨されます。
冷却システム
CPUは、マイニング中に大量の熱を発生します。そのため、適切な冷却システムが必要です。空冷クーラーや水冷クーラーを使用することで、CPUの温度を適切に管理することができます。特に、ハイエンドCPUを使用する場合は、高性能な冷却システムが不可欠です。
ネットワーク環境
モネロのマイニングには、安定したネットワーク環境が必要です。高速なインターネット回線を使用することで、マイニングプールとの通信をスムーズに行うことができます。
設備投資の目安
モネロマイニングの設備投資額は、使用するCPUの性能や台数、その他のコンポーネントの品質によって大きく異なります。以下に、いくつかのケースにおける設備投資の目安を示します。
エントリーレベル
予算を抑えたい場合は、中古のCPUやマザーボードを使用することができます。この場合、設備投資額は、およそ10万円~20万円程度になります。ただし、マイニング性能は低くなるため、収益もそれほど期待できません。
ミドルレベル
ある程度のマイニング性能を求める場合は、最新のCPUやマザーボードを使用することができます。この場合、設備投資額は、およそ30万円~50万円程度になります。ミドルレベルの設備であれば、ある程度の収益を期待できます。
ハイレベル
最大限のマイニング性能を求める場合は、ハイエンドCPUを複数台搭載したシステムを構築する必要があります。この場合、設備投資額は、およそ100万円以上になる可能性があります。ハイレベルの設備であれば、高い収益を期待できますが、初期投資額も大きくなります。
上記の設備投資額はあくまで目安であり、実際の費用は、購入するコンポーネントの価格や販売店によって異なります。また、電気代や設置場所の費用なども考慮する必要があります。
モネロマイニングの収益性
モネロマイニングの収益性は、モネロの価格、ネットワークの難易度、電気代、マイニング設備の性能など、様々な要因によって変動します。一般的に、モネロの価格が上昇すると収益も増加し、ネットワークの難易度が上昇すると収益は減少します。また、電気代が高い地域では、収益が圧迫される可能性があります。
マイニングの収益性を計算するには、以下の要素を考慮する必要があります。
- ハッシュレート: マイニング設備のハッシュレート(単位時間あたりに実行できるハッシュ計算の回数)
- モネロの価格: モネロの市場価格
- ネットワークの難易度: モネロネットワークの難易度
- ブロック報酬: 新規ブロックを生成したマイナーに支払われる報酬
- 電気代: マイニング設備の消費電力と電気料金
これらの要素を考慮して、マイニングの収益性を慎重に評価する必要があります。
モネロマイニングのリスク
モネロマイニングには、いくつかのリスクが伴います。
- 価格変動リスク: モネロの価格は、市場の状況によって大きく変動する可能性があります。
- 難易度上昇リスク: モネロネットワークの難易度は、マイニングに参加するマイナーの数が増えるにつれて上昇する可能性があります。
- 設備故障リスク: マイニング設備は、故障する可能性があります。
- 電気代上昇リスク: 電気料金は、上昇する可能性があります。
- 規制リスク: 暗号資産に関する規制は、変更される可能性があります。
これらのリスクを十分に理解した上で、モネロマイニングへの参入を検討する必要があります。
まとめ
モネロのマイニングは、RandomXアルゴリズムを採用しており、CPUマイニングに適しています。設備投資額は、使用するCPUの性能や台数によって大きく異なりますが、エントリーレベルからハイレベルまで、様々な選択肢があります。モネロマイニングの収益性は、モネロの価格、ネットワークの難易度、電気代など、様々な要因によって変動します。モネロマイニングには、価格変動リスク、難易度上昇リスク、設備故障リスクなど、いくつかのリスクが伴います。これらのリスクを十分に理解した上で、慎重に検討することが重要です。モネロマイニングは、適切な設備投資とリスク管理を行うことで、収益性の高い投資となる可能性があります。